Holiday Clean-Up Challenge

For the next two weeks our Simple Daily Challenges will be focussed on tidying, cleaning and maintaining our homes for the busy holiday month of December. Let the Holiday Clean-Up begin:

What to expect:

Mondays- clutter maintenance and organizing boost

Tuesdays- Take 5 – a 5 minute challenge of cleaning or planning

Wednesdays-  Something will get shined in a room some place

Thursdays-  3 Simple Tasks

Fridays- 10 minutes challenge of Holiday Cleaning that can be finished up over the weekend.

Saturdays- 15 minute challenge of Deep Cleaning

Sundays – Mommy Maintenance – a challenge for just us girls to look our best this month.

 

Please remember, this is just enough cleaning to have friends and family over. I am choosing spots that I feel need the most attention. This is not a mega-spring cleaning but a company touch-up.
